Submission Guidelines
 

All submissions

  • If submitted material is still under development, please indicate.

  • Provide addresses for all hypertext links external to the School's pages. This includes addresses for University pages.

  • For internal links, please state clearly which page is to be linked to by either giving the page title or address.

  • All individuals must ensure that they own copyright or have permission from the copyright holder for the material submitted.

 

Documents for publication (eg. handbooks, timetables, forms)

  • Where an original document exists, eg. handbooks it is up to the individual to make all necessary edits before submitting for publication.

  • Most documents submitted in Word format will be converted to pdfs. (Unless further editing is required by the user).

  • It is up to the individual to maintain and keep all original documents. The original documents will not be kept by the web administrators.

 

Editing of web pages

  • The web administrators will edit all html pages where no original document exists.

  • When an html page requires small edits please print out the page and indicate on the print out what changes are required.

  • When sections within an html document require editing please write out the new sections (in email or in Word) and indicate clearly which paragraphs/sections of the existing page are to be replaced.

  • When an html page requires extensive editing, please cut and paste the material to Word and make the required edits. This document should then be sent to one of the web administrators to be converted to html.
